Understanding Zinc and Its Importance
Zinc is an essential mineral that plays a crucial role in various bodily functions. It is vital for immune system support, wound healing, DNA synthesis, and protein production. Additionally, zinc contributes to healthy skin, taste perception, and even cognitive function. The body does not store zinc, so it is essential to consume adequate amounts through diet or supplementation.
The Effects of Alcohol on Zinc Levels
Research indicates that alcohol consumption can negatively impact zinc levels in the body. Several studies have shown that individuals who consume alcohol regularly may have lower serum zinc concentrations compared to non-drinkers. This can be attributed to several factors:
1. Decreased Absorption: Alcohol can interfere with the absorption of zinc in the intestines, leading to deficiencies over time.
2. Increased Excretion: Chronic alcohol consumption can increase the excretion of zinc through urine, further reducing the levels in the body.
3. Dietary Choices: People who consume alcohol may not prioritize a balanced diet, which can lead to inadequate zinc intake.
Signs of Zinc Deficiency
Zinc deficiency can manifest in various ways, including:
– Weakened immune response, leading to frequent infections
– Delayed wound healing
– Hair loss and skin issues
– Loss of taste or smell
– Cognitive difficulties
If you are a regular alcohol consumer and experience any of these symptoms, it may be a good idea to assess your zinc levels.

Choosing the Right Zinc Supplement
When selecting a zinc supplement, it is essential to consider the form and dosage. Zinc supplements are available in various forms, including zinc gluconate, zinc acetate, and zinc picolinate. Each form has different absorption rates and bioavailability, so it may be beneficial to consult with a healthcare professional to determine the best option for your needs.
Additionally, pay attention to the dosage. The recommended dietary allowance (RDA) for zinc varies by age and gender, but for adult men, it is typically 11 mg per day, and for adult women, it is 8 mg per day. It’s essential not to exceed the upper intake level of 40 mg per day unless advised by a healthcare professional, as excessive zinc can lead to toxicity.
